2025 JHI SSHRC Grant Writing Bootcamp – Jackman Humanities Institute

Event Overlay

Are you planning to apply for a SSHRC Insight Grant or Insight Development Grant in an upcoming competition? Do you feel daunted by the SSHRC grant writing process?

Join the Jackman Humanities Institute for an eight-week intensive bootcamp, which is designed to help you prepare a winning grant application that advances your research program in exciting ways. The bootcamp focuses on the three main components of any SSHRC funding application: the Detailed Description, the Knowledge Mobilization plan, and the Budget.

  • Practical Exercises: Engage in writing exercises and other activities designed to prompt creative thinking around your draft
  • Peer Review: Receive valuable feedback from your colleagues in the final Peer Review session

The sessions are divided into:

  • Faculty speaker sessions featuring recent SSHRC grant recipients who will discuss and demonstrate their successful applications
  • In-depth guidance and information sessions from Divisional Research Officers who will provide tips and best practices
  • Co-working blocks (optional) featuring writing sprints, visualization strategies and dedicated writing time

The program runs on Tuesdays and Thursdays from June 3 to July 22, 2025. Participation in the bootcamp requires attendance at all of the Tuesday sessions.

The deadline for registration is May 12, 2025 at 4 pm (ET).
